一種DMA數(shù)據(jù)同步傳輸變異步傳輸?shù)姆椒?/p>
基本信息
申請?zhí)?/td> | CN201910230653.1 | 申請日 | - |
公開(公告)號 | CN109857686B | 公開(公告)日 | 2020-12-29 |
申請公布號 | CN109857686B | 申請公布日 | 2020-12-29 |
分類號 | G06F13/28 | 分類 | 計算;推算;計數(shù); |
發(fā)明人 | 張志運 | 申請(專利權(quán))人 | 北京簡約納電子有限公司 |
代理機構(gòu) | 南京正聯(lián)知識產(chǎn)權(quán)代理有限公司 | 代理人 | 郭俊玲 |
地址 | 100088 北京市海淀區(qū)知春路6號錦秋國大廈B區(qū)1001、1002室 | ||
法律狀態(tài) | - |
摘要
摘要 | 本發(fā)明公開了一種DMA數(shù)據(jù)同步傳輸變異步傳輸?shù)姆椒?,S1、將傳輸?shù)漠?dāng)前數(shù)據(jù)包設(shè)置為高優(yōu)先級任務(wù),由CPU分配資源給所述當(dāng)前是數(shù)據(jù)包;S2、在CPU給所述當(dāng)前數(shù)據(jù)包分配好資源的傳輸過程中啟動與所述當(dāng)前數(shù)據(jù)包對應(yīng)的DMA傳輸,將所述DMA傳輸轉(zhuǎn)至低優(yōu)先級任務(wù);S3、釋放高優(yōu)先級任務(wù)占用的CPU資源,由CPU分配所述MDA傳輸所需的資源,完成所述DMA傳輸;S4、重復(fù)步驟S1~S3,實現(xiàn)下一數(shù)據(jù)包及其對應(yīng)的DMA傳輸?shù)臄?shù)據(jù)傳輸操作;本發(fā)明可將數(shù)據(jù)傳輸過程中與數(shù)據(jù)包對應(yīng)的DMA傳輸與數(shù)據(jù)包傳輸異步傳輸,提高數(shù)據(jù)包的傳輸效率,并提升CPU利用率。 |
